Obtained a Viking 32 MB PCMCIA card (Cisco's according to reseller) and inserted in slot1. The first time I formatted slot1 I got errors, second , third etc. no errors. When I try to copy to slot1 from tftp server it will copy to 98% then get timeout errors. I used both Cisco's and Solar Winds TFTP servers. (Little or no network traffic at that time of night). Tried downloading the file (rsp-jsv-mz.122-2.T.bin) again with the same results. Any idea as why it dies at 98%?

Do not use cisco's tftp server..it is having some issues with it. Actually Solar Winds shouldwork..Try to download pumkin tftp server from www.download.com..people is having good success with it.

Pumpkin is definitely better for large files. Also, you can use FTP or SCP with routers to move files.

Thanks. I downloaded a number of TFTP servers including Pumkin and ver 5 of the SolarWInds TFTP server. SolarWinds ver 5 worked. The only theory I have is that the old version 4 may have a 16MB file size limit.
